What are the benefits and drawbacks of TD Ameritrades forex leverage?

1. Benefits of TD Ameritrade’s Forex Leverage

1.1 Increased Trading Power

One of the main benefits of TD Ameritrade’s forex leverage is the ability to access greater trading power. Leverage allows you to control larger positions with a smaller amount of capital. This can potentially amplify your trading profits if your trades are successful.

1.2 Diversification Opportunities

TD Ameritrade offers a wide range of currency pairs to trade with leverage. This provides traders with opportunities to diversify their portfolios and take advantage of various market movements. Diversification can help spread risk and increase the potential for profitable trades.

1.3 Flexibility in Trading Strategies

Forex leverage offered by TD Ameritrade allows traders to implement different trading strategies. Whether you prefer day trading, swing trading, or long-term investing, leverage can enhance the potential returns of your chosen strategy.

2. Drawbacks of TD Ameritrade’s Forex Leverage

2.1 Increased Risk

While leverage can amplify potential profits, it also increases the risk of losses. Trading with leverage means that even small price movements can have a significant impact on your account balance. It’s crucial to have a solid risk management plan in place when trading with leverage to protect your capital.

2.2 Margin Requirements

TD Ameritrade imposes margin requirements, which determine the amount of capital you need to have in your account to support leveraged positions. Higher leverage ratios typically require higher margin requirements. Traders must ensure they have sufficient funds to meet these requirements and avoid margin calls or forced liquidation of positions.

2.3 Regulatory Restrictions

TD Ameritrade, like any regulated broker, must comply with regulatory guidelines. Regulatory bodies often impose restrictions on leverage to protect retail traders from excessive risk. This means that the maximum leverage available at TD Ameritrade may be subject to regulatory limitations.
